TITLEIST PRO V1

The Titleist Pro V1 was launched in October 2000 after years of development combining the performance of wound and solid-core balls. Initially just a temporary lab name, the "Pro V1" stuck after its immediate success on the PGA Tour, where 47 players immediately put it in play at the Invensys Classic. The ball quickly became the number one selling golf ball, a position it has held for over 25 years due to continuous innovation.


Key milestones and history

Pre-2000: Titleist engineers worked for years to combine the performance of high-end wound balls and distance-focused solid-core balls, creating many prototypes. 

Summer 2000: Over 100 PGA Tour players were given prototypes to test, with feedback confirming they had created something revolutionary. 

October 11, 2000: The Pro V1 was officially introduced on the PGA Tour at the Invensys Classic in Las Vegas. 
Initial adoption: A total of 47 players, including winner Billy Andrade, immediately switched to the new ball, representing the largest single-event equipment shift in golf history. 

Public release: Due to overwhelming demand and the ball's immediate success, the public release was moved forward from March 2001 to December 2000. 

The name: The name "Pro V1" was a temporary designation for a prototype ball submitted to the USGA for testing. "Pro" stood for "Professional," "V" for "Veneer" (the material layer), and "1" because it was the first prototype in that series. The name stuck because of its immediate success. 

Continued innovation: Since its debut, Titleist has continued to innovate with the Pro V1, leading to its sustained position as the number one ball in golf for over 25 years.
